What is an Axiom?

An Axiom job typically refers to a role at Axiom, a company that provides flexible legal talent and technology-driven legal services. Axiom hires experienced lawyers, legal consultants, and professionals to work on engagements with corporate clients on an as-needed basis. These roles offer flexibility and variety, allowing legal professionals to work on high-profile projects without the constraints of traditional law firm structures.

How does working as an attorney at Axiom differ from traditional law firms in terms of team structure and client engagement?

Attorneys at Axiom typically operate within a flexible, project-based model, collaborating directly with clients' in-house legal teams rather than working in a traditional law firm hierarchy. This structure allows lawyers to focus on specific client needs, often embedding with the client's team for the duration of a project or engagement. Unlike at conventional firms, Axiom attorneys may gain exposure to a variety of industries and legal challenges, broadening their experience and skill set. This environment encourages autonomy, adaptability, and frequent collaboration with both legal and business professionals, fostering a dynamic and client-centered work culture.

Summary/Objective:

We are seeking a highly experienced and driven Senior MEP Superintendent to lead and manage all mechanical, electrical, and plumbing (MEP) operations on large-scale commercial construction projects. The Senior MEP Superintendent plays a critical role in delivering complex projects by overseeing field execution, coordinating trades, enforcing safety, and ensuring compliance with plans, codes, and quality standards.

This leadership position is ideal for candidates with a proven track record of success in managing MEP scopes as Superintendent on high-value, fast-paced construction projects such as hospitals, data centers, high-rise buildings, or advanced manufacturing facilities.
